summ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orJared Adams <jaxad0127@gmail.com>2010-03-02 13:34:11 +0000
committerJared Adams <jaxad0127@gmail.com>2010-03-02 13:34:11 +0000
commit4ff5c3b854215b1f55e70106a4c53225fc953619 (patch)
tree7a7c43fb950add7ab991459cf91af23c02cb4309 /src
parentd194ea8220658b6ef84522f01fa3cf0d0200545e (diff)
downloadmana-4ff5c3b854215b1f55e70106a4c53225fc953619.tar.gz
mana-4ff5c3b854215b1f55e70106a4c53225fc953619.tar.bz2
mana-4ff5c3b854215b1f55e70106a4c53225fc953619.tar.xz
mana-4ff5c3b854215b1f55e70106a4c53225fc953619.zip
Revert "Fix using custom cursors"
This reverts commit d194ea8220658b6ef84522f01fa3cf0d0200545e.
Diffstat (limited to 'src')
-rw-r--r--src/gui/viewport.cpp7
1 files changed, 2 insertions, 5 deletions
diff --git a/src/gui/viewport.cpp b/src/gui/viewport.cpp
index 9633cbd5..a36f91cf 100644
--- a/src/gui/viewport.cpp
+++ b/src/gui/viewport.cpp
@@ -468,7 +468,8 @@ void Viewport::mouseMoved(gcn::MouseEvent &event)
const int y = (event.getY() + (int) mPixelViewY);
mHoverBeing = beingManager->findBeingByPixel(x, y);
- if (mHoverBeing && mHoverBeing->getType() == Being::PLAYER)
+ if (mHoverBeing && mHoverBeing->getType() == Being::PLAYER &&
+ event.getSource() == this)
mBeingPopup->show(getMouseX(), getMouseY(),
static_cast<Player*>(mHoverBeing));
else
@@ -477,10 +478,6 @@ void Viewport::mouseMoved(gcn::MouseEvent &event)
mHoverItem = floorItemManager->findByCoordinates(x / mMap->getTileWidth(),
y / mMap->getTileHeight());
- // Don't change the cursor if the mouse is over something else
- if (event.getSource() != this)
- return;
-
if (mHoverBeing)
{
switch (mHoverBeing->getType())